Benares Hotels Ltd has published notices in newspapers (Financial Express in Delhi and Mumbai editions, and Hindustan in Varanasi edition) on June 18, 2025, reminding shareholders about the upcoming transfer of their shares to the Investor Education and Protection Fund (IEPF). The company also sent reminder letters dated June 12, 2025 to shareholders who have not claimed dividends for seven consecutive years starting from the unpaid Final Dividend for FY 2017-18. Affected shareholders have been asked to claim their unpaid dividends on or before August 31, 2025, failing which their shares will be moved to the IEPF Demat Account during FY 2025-26. After transfer, shareholders can reclaim their shares by filing IEPF-5 form with the IEPF Authority. The company's Registrar and Transfer Agent for this process is MUFG Intime India Private Limited.
This is a routine regulatory compliance announcement and does not directly affect active shareholders. Shareholders who have not claimed dividends since FY 2017-18 should act before August 31, 2025 to avoid losing their shares to the IEPF.
